Why Patients Choose Online Pharmacies
The shift towards buying prescriptions over the internet is driven by numerous engaging elements. For individuals managing persistent conditions or those with limited movement, the digital drug store design eliminates standard barriers to health care access.
- Benefit and Time-Saving: No more waiting in long lines at the brick-and-mortar pharmacy. Prescriptions are provided straight to the patient's doorstep.
- Price Transparency: Online platforms frequently make it easier to compare drug rates, discover generic alternatives, and apply discount rate vouchers.
- Personal privacy: For delicate medical conditions, purchasing online provides a discreet shopping experience without the stress and anxiety of in person interactions at a local counter.
- Automated Refills: Many digital pharmacies use membership models that automatically refill and deliver medications before they run out, decreasing the danger of missed out on doses.

Safety must constantly be the leading priority when acquiring pharmaceuticals over the internet. To safeguard health and monetary wellness, patients need to follow a rigorous vetting process before getting in payment information.
1. Constantly Require a Valid Prescription
No genuine drug store will give prescription-only medication without a prescription issued by a licensed doctor. If an online platform provides to offer prescription drugs "no prescription needed" or uses a fast questionnaire in lieu of a genuine doctor's evaluation, it is running unlawfully and precariously.
2. Confirm the Pharmacy's Credentials
In the United States, look for drug stores certified by the National Association of Boards of Pharmacy (NABP) through their VIPPS (Verified Internet Pharmacy Practice Sites) program or those displaying the (. drug store) top-level domain. In Canada, examine the Canadian International Pharmacy Association (CIPA).
3. Ensure a Licensed Pharmacist is Available
A reliable online pharmacy always supplies access to a certified pharmacist to respond to concerns about drug interactions, negative effects, or proper dosage. Look for a clearly displayed telephone number or client service chat feature.
4. Secure Personal and Financial Information
Guarantee the website uses secure encryption technology. Search for "https://" at the start of the web address and a padlock icon in the internet browser bar. Never share delicate information like Social Security numbers unless it is strictly needed and encrypted.
Red Flags: How to Spot an Illicit Online Pharmacy
According to regulative bodies like the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A), countless fraudulent online drug stores run worldwide. See out for these caution signs:
- No physical address or contact information noted on the website beyond a web form.
- Deeply discounted costs that seem "too excellent to be real" (e.g., 80% off brand-name drugs).
- International shipping from unknown origins when buying from domestic suppliers.
- Unsolicited spam e-mails offering cheap prescription drugs without a physician's see.

Q3: How can I inspect if an online drug store is safe?
A: You can examine the NABP site (safe.pharmacy) to confirm if an online American Pharmacy is licensed in your state and satisfies safety requirements. You should also examine that they need a valid doctor's prescription.
Q4: Are online medications cheaper than those at local drug stores?
A: They can be, particularly when acquiring generic medications or utilizing online discount programs. However, consumers ought to always focus on safety and confirmation over discovering the absolute least expensive price.
Q5: What should I do if I believe my online medication is counterfeit?
A: Stop taking the medication instantly. Contact your recommending physician and report the occurrence to your regional health authority or nationwide regulative firm (such as the FDA's MedWatch program in the U.S.). Keep the product packaging and tablets for investigation.
